Analysis

What drives eviction risk in Lyndale

The dominant input is tenant-organizing strength at 8.1/10. Average gross rent is $1,170, 28% above the Winchester average. Well under the midpoint, state political climate reads 2.1/10.

On the softer side, eviction-process difficulty reads 2.1/10. On the national scale it lands near the 38th percentile of the 84,120 tracts scored.

At 12% renter-occupied this is predominantly owner territory, and comps have to be drawn from further out. Social vulnerability reads 1.8/10 on the CDC index, a measure of exposure to housing and economic shocks.

Against average income of $86,042, annual rent is just 16%. Of its three components the housing type and transport measure is the least pressured. It tracks the Clark County average of 3.9 closely.

These are ACS 5-year estimates; the score moves when the ACS, court-record, or statute inputs behind it move.
